Shared accommodation | Annemasse (74100)
Shared accommodation | Gex (01170)
Shared accommodation | Annemasse (74100) | 18 M2
Shared accommodation | Annemasse (74100) | 107 M2
Shared accommodation | Annemasse (74100)
Shared accommodation | Ambilly
Shared accommodation | Annemasse (74100) | 110 M2
Shared accommodation | Annemasse (74100) | 10 M2
Shared accommodation | Annemasse (74100)
Shared accommodation | Thônex
Shared accommodation | Puplinge (1241)
Shared accommodation | Puplinge (1241)
Shared accommodation | Genève (1290)
Shared accommodation | Nonglard (74330) | 74 M2
Shared accommodation | Grilly (01220)
Shared accommodation | Meinier (1252) | 20 M2
Shared accommodation | Charvonnex (74370)
Shared accommodation | Grilly (01220)